[Résolu] Network-manager attribue uniquement adresse IPv6

Bonjour à tous,

J’ai un ordinateur portable sous Debian Sid/Testing, et je suis plutôt satisfait de la façon dont il tourne.
Cela faisait un petit moment que je n’avais plus fait de mises à jour, et ce dimanche, j’ai remis à jour un sacré nombre de paquets…

J’ai perdu la connexion au réseau (ethernet et wifi) après reboot. En fouillant un peu, je me suis rendu compte que network-manager ne m’attribue plus que des adresses en IPv6. J’ai remis le paquets plus ancien de Testing ( network-manager 0.9.4.0-10 au lieu de 0.9.8.8-5), mais rien n’y fait, j’ai toujours une adresse IPv6, et pas d’IPv4.

Quand je suis chez moi, je contourne le problème en déclarant mon IP et ma gateway avec ifconfig wlan0 X.X.X etc…(c’est comme ça que je peux poster ! :slightly_smiling: ), mais du coup, je ne peux plus récupérer d’adresse par DHCP, et donc me connecter sur un autre réseau que le mien.

Est-ce que quelqu’un aurait une idée pour régler ce problème ?

En vous remerciant,

Darckense

Salut,

Tu peux toujours virer la config de network manager, puis réinstaller la version du paquet.
As-tu “purgé” pour la désinstallation ?

salut,
si tu cliques sur l’icone network-manager -> parametres du réseau puis sur la roue crantée pour les options tu as accès aux paramètres ipv4 et ipv6. Ton ipv4 est peut-etre desactive

Bonjour,

Merci pour vos réponses.

Concernant le widget plasma, non, malheureusement, l’IPv4 est bien activé…

Je viens de purger l’installation de network-manager et plasma-nm, et de réinstaller les nouveaux paquets. Malheureusement, rien ne change, je reste toujours avec une adresse en IPv6.

J’avoue que je sèche… :confused:


Darckense

Re-bonjour,

En fait, je pense que je dois mal purger les fichiers de configurations de network-manager, car mes préférences réseau (mot de passe du réseau wifi…) ainsi que les connections VPN que j’ai configuré apparaissent toujours.

J’ai désinstallé network-manager et plasma-nm en faisant (en root) :

aptitude purge network-manager

aptitude purge plasma-nm

Y a-t-il quelquechose d’autre que je doive faire pour réinitialiser complètement la configuration du réseau ?

Merci,


Darckense

Salut
wiki.gnome.org/Projects/Network … emSettings
Vérifie /etc/NetworkManager/system-connections

j’ai un fichier “Wired connection 1” dans lequel on trouve:

[code][ipv6]
method=ignore
ip6-privacy=2

[ipv4]
method=auto
[/code]

Bonjour,

Effectivement, j’ai toutes mes anciennes connections wifi et mes VPN ici. Merci pour l’info, je ne connaissais pas.

Quoi qu’il en soit, voici ce que j’ai pour l’ethernet et la connection wifi ou je me connecte :

root@transit:/etc/NetworkManager/system-connections# cat Auto\ eth0 
[802-3-ethernet]
port=mii

[connection]
id=Auto eth0
uuid=903f1668-7ddd-4ca1-a1a3-a16e767c54d0
type=802-3-ethernet
timestamp=1371412265
zone=

[ipv6]
method=auto
ip6-privacy=0

[ipv4]
method=auto
may-fail=false
root@transit:/etc/NetworkManager/system-connections# cat mon_ssid
[connection]
id=mon_ssid
uuid=20349106-236b-439d-9ddf-97fb90802fae
type=802-11-wireless

[802-11-wireless]
ssid=mon_ssid
mode=infrastructure
security=802-11-wireless-security

[802-11-wireless-security]
key-mgmt=wpa-psk
psk=mon_password

[ipv4]
method=auto

[ipv6]
method=ignore

Voici également le résultat de ifconfig (j’ai remplacé les adresses MAC et IP par des XX) :

root@transit:/home/darckense# ifconfig 
eth0      Link encap:Ethernet  HWaddr aa:XX:XX:XX:XX:XX  
          UP BROADCAST M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 lg file transmission:1000 
          RX bytes:0 (0.0 B)  TX bytes:0 (0.0 B)
          Interruption:18 Mémoire:b9100000-b9120000 

lo        Link encap:Boucle locale  
          inet adr:127.0.0.1  Masque:255.0.0.0
          adr inet6: ::1/128 Scope:Hôte
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:330 errors:0 dropped:0 overruns:0 frame:0
          TX packets:330 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 lg file transmission:0 
          RX bytes:38465 (37.5 KiB)  TX bytes:38465 (37.5 KiB)

wlan0     Link encap:Ethernet  HWaddr 00:XX:XX:XX:XX:XX  
          adr inet6: 2a01:XXX:XXX:XXX:XXX:XXX:XXX:XXX/64 Scope:Global
          adr inet6: fe80::XXX:XXX:XXX:XXX/64 Scope:Lien
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:22 errors:0 dropped:0 overruns:0 frame:0
          TX packets:141 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 lg file transmission:1000 
          RX bytes:3572 (3.4 KiB)  TX bytes:17404 (16.9 KiB)
 

Pour me connecter, je fait :

root@transit:/home/darckense# ifconfig wlan0 192.168.1.7
root@transit:/home/darckense# route add default gw 192.168.1.254 dev wlan0

Et ensuite, ifconfig donne :

root@transit:/home/darckense# ifconfig 
eth0      Link encap:Ethernet  HWaddr aa:XX:XX:XX:XX:XX  
          UP BROADCAST M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 lg file transmission:1000 
          RX bytes:0 (0.0 B)  TX bytes:0 (0.0 B)
          Interruption:18 Mémoire:b9100000-b9120000 

lo        Link encap:Boucle locale  
          inet adr:127.0.0.1  Masque:255.0.0.0
          adr inet6: ::1/128 Scope:Hôte
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:439 errors:0 dropped:0 overruns:0 frame:0
          TX packets:439 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 lg file transmission:0 
          RX bytes:60162 (58.7 KiB)  TX bytes:60162 (58.7 KiB)

wlan0     Link encap:Ethernet  HWaddr 00:XX:XX:XX:XX:XX  
          inet adr:192.168.1.7  Bcast:192.168.1.255  Masque:255.255.255.0
          adr inet6: 2a01:XXX:XXX:XXX:XXX:XXX:XXX:XXX/64 Scope:Global
          adr inet6: fe80::XXX:XXX:XXX:XXX/64 Scope:Lien
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:53 errors:0 dropped:0 overruns:0 frame:0
          TX packets:230 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 lg file transmission:1000 
          RX bytes:7983 (7.7 KiB)  TX bytes:29329 (28.6 KiB)

Je suis connecté derrière une freebox, et sur le réseau local l’IP de mon ordi est 192.168.1.7 (normalement attribué par DHCP avec l’adresse MAC).

Etonnamment, mon fichier /etc/resolv.conf est bien configuré par Network manager.

Quelqu’un a une idée ?

Merci,


Darckense

Je viens de mettre network-manager à jour vers la version 0.9.8.8-7, et cela a résolu mon problème. Tout refonctionne normalement. J’ai du faire l’expérience d’un bug étrange… :slightly_smiling:

Merci pour vos conseils,


Darckense

Wow merci. 3 jours que je m’arrache les cheveux sur ce problème sans rien comprendre.
J’étais dans le même état que toi :

# apt-cache policy network-manager network-manager: Installé : 0.9.4.0-10 Candidat : 0.9.8.8-7

J’ai mis à jour (via un dist-upgrade) vers la 0.9.8.8-7 et tout fonctionne.
Encore merci! :slightly_smiling: